QuickBooks Online integration

Where you connect the platform to QuickBooks Online, you authorize us to access the QuickBooks Online data associated with the connected account through Intuit's OAuth 2.0 authorization framework, solely to provide the platform to you.

You represent that you are an authorized administrator of the connected QuickBooks Online account, or that you have obtained appropriate authorization from an administrator, to grant that access.

We access categories of QuickBooks Online data including chart of accounts, vendors, items, purchases, bills, and Profit and Loss report data. The specific categories may change as the platform evolves and will be described in our documentation.

You may disconnect the QuickBooks Online integration at any time through the platform or through your Intuit account. After disconnection we will stop retrieving new data. Data previously ingested will be handled in accordance with our Data Use Policy.

Your use of QuickBooks Online is governed by your agreement with Intuit. We are not a party to that agreement and are not responsible for the QuickBooks Online service.

Your data and AI features

The business data you bring to the platform is yours. You grant us a limited license to host, process, transmit, and display that data only to the extent necessary to provide the platform, prevent or address technical problems, or as you expressly direct. You are responsible for the accuracy, quality, and legality of the data you submit.

You may not submit protected health information regulated under HIPAA, cardholder data subject to PCI DSS, information of children under 13, or other sensitive data categories requiring special protection under applicable law, unless we have a separate written agreement expressly permitting that use.

The platform includes AI features that use large language models from third-party providers. We do not use your business data to train, fine-tune, or otherwise improve any generally available machine learning model, and our agreements with our AI subprocessors prohibit them from doing so. AI-generated answers are probabilistic and may contain errors. You are responsible for reviewing them before relying on them for material decisions.
